I guess this thread has dwindled to pretty much just rare posts by me. But just in case anybody else happens by I'll throw out a recommendation for The Bear. It's streaming on hulu (but I think it's made by FX so maybe you can see it there too?) I guess it'd be classified as a dramedy if it had to be classified. If you like food and/or Chicago, it might get your "chef's kiss". I've seen where restaurant workers say it's the most realistic depiction they've seen of a casual mom-and-pop place.
The main cast isn't very well known except for the protagonist having been on "Shameless". But there's more than one interesting cameo that had me wondering "hey isn't that...?".
Only one season is out and there's no word that I've seen on whether there will be a season 2. It's a pretty easy binge with only 8 episodes of very roughly a half-hour each. Has some cool music too.

One of my favorite scenes the show ever did was where Saul tricked the court and had someone other than the defendant sitting next to him while his client was in the courtroom elsewhere. The witness identified the guy sitting next to him.
As someone who does a lot of defense work it always bugs me how we do identification in court. Prosecutor asks if the person is in the court room and the witness points to the guy in jail clothes sitting next to his attorney... It's built for confirmation bias.
